Man dressed in purdah attempts to rob Canara Bank branch near Dharapuram in movie style

A young man who tried to rob a Canara bank branch at Alangiyam near Dharapuram was caught by the public and handed over to the police.



Tirupur: A man who tried to rob a private bank near Dharapuram in Tirupur district has been caught by the public and handed over to the police.

Jayakumar is a resident of Gandhi Nagar near Dharapuram. His son Suresh (19) is a second-year student of a private polytechnic college in Dharapuram.



Suresh, a young man, had entered Canara bank wearing a black purdah and carrying in his hand, a gun and a time bomb as he planned to rob the Canara bank in movie style.



He threatened the bank manager with a knife and threatened to detonate the bomb and tried to rob him. Due to this, there was a lot of tension in the Alangiyam area.

One of the customers who came there hit Suresh on the head and the public surrounded him and caught him. The Alangiyam police were then informed.



Following this, the Alangiyam police, who reached the spot, arrested Suresh and took him to Alangiyam police station for questioning.

Dharapuram DSP Dhanarasu, inspector Manikandan and others interrogated Suresh, who was wearing a purdah, and found that he was involved in the bank robbery after watching movies.

The police investigation revealed that he had purchased a dummy hand gun, dummy time palm, knife and black purdah, through an online shopping platform.

Suresh has been admitted to the Dharapuram Government Hospital for treatment of a head injury sustained while being rounded up by the public.
